Too many geckos in the house, here's a little trick to make them 'go away and never come back





Geckos are reptiles that often appear around our homes.
Although they are useful in dealing with harmful insects such as mosquitoes, ants, and cockroaches, they also carry a type of bacteria called salmonella, which can cause illness in humans.

What’s even more troublesome is their droppings. Not only do they make the house dirty, but they can also become a breeding ground for mold, potentially causing disease. That’s why most homemakers want to get rid of them.

When dealing with geckos, you don’t have to harm them. Just using a few simple methods can drive them out of your home.

A Few Simple Ways to Repel Geckos

1. Use Eggshells


This is a cost-free and highly effective folk remedy. When you eat chicken or duck eggs, don’t throw the shells away. Place the eggshells in the corners of your home, in drawers, under the bed, in cabinets, or on kitchen shelves. Geckos are terrified of the smell of eggshells because chickens are their natural predator. So when they detect the “scent of chicken,” they panic and run off.

3. Use Garlic and Onions

Garlic and onions are essential kitchen ingredients. Besides enhancing food flavor, they are also effective in repelling geckos.

If you pay close attention, you’ll notice that where garlic is present, geckos rarely show up. Place garlic in areas geckos frequent, and they’ll stay away. You can also blend garlic into a paste, put it into a spray bottle, and spray it onto walls and corners where geckos appear.

Sliced onions are another strong irritant. Peel and chop the onion into small pieces, then place them where geckos usually hide. The pungent smell scares them away.

4. Use Pepper and Chili

Pepper and chili are common spices with a strong, spicy aroma. This scent makes geckos avoid the area. The method is similar to using garlic and onions. Spray the mixture behind the refrigerator, behind sofas, and on walls—warm, narrow spaces where geckos like to live. The fumes from pepper and chili can irritate their eyes and cause burning sensations on their skin when they come into contact with the mixture.

5. Use Lemongrass and Lemon Essential Oil

You can easily buy lemongrass-lemon essential oil at grocery or convenience stores. Dilute a few drops in water and spray it on walls and ceilings. You can also use an essential oil diffuser or hang scented sachets in areas where geckos normally appear. Once they smell it, they will run away and not return.
